The present study describes the encapsulation of vegetable fats (cocoa butter and mango butter) within chitosan microparticles by double emulsion technique to prevent leaching of the internal apolar phase. Leaching studies suggested negligible leaching of the internal phase (~12–14%) when the fats were encapsulated as compared to the control (~40%). Fourier transform infrared spectroscopy and differential scanning calorimeter studies confirmed the successful encapsulation of fats. The release of drug (ciprofloxacin) from the microparticles was diffusion and erosion mediated and were capable to elicit antimicrobial activity against Escherichia coli. The study suggests that the developed microparticles have the potential for controlled delivery of antimicrobials.  相似文献

Price declines and volume growth of concentrated photovoltaic (CPV) systems are analysed using the learning curve methodology and compared with other forms of solar electricity generation. Logarithmic regression analysis determines a learning rate of 18% for CPV systems with 90% confidence of that rate being between 14 and 22%, which is higher than the learning rates of other solar generation systems (11% for CSP and 12 to 14% for PV). Current CPV system prices are competitive with PV and CSP, which, when combined with the higher learning rate, indicates that CPV is likely to further improve its marketability. A target price of 1 $/W in 2020 could be achieved with a compound growth rate of 67% for the total deployed volume between 2014 and 2020, which would realize a cumulative deployed volume of 7900 MW. Other projections of deployment volumes from commercial sources are converted using the learning rate into future price scenarios, resulting in predicted prices in the range of 1.1 to 1.3 $/W in 2020. © 2014 The Authors. We address the problem of minimizing makespan on identical parallel machines. We propose new lower bounding strategies and heuristics for this fundamental scheduling problem. The lower bounds are based on the so‐called lifting procedure. In addition, two optimization‐based heuristics are proposed. These heuristics require iteratively solving a subset‐sum problem. We present the results of computational experiments that provide strong evidence that the new proposed lower and upper bounds consistently outperform the best bounds from the literature.  相似文献

Classifying tropical wood species poses a considerable economic challenge and failure to classify the wood species accurately can have significant effects on timber industries. The problem of wood recognition is compounded with the nonlinearities of the features among the similar wood species. Besides that, large wood databases presented a problem of large processing time especially for online wood recognition system. In view of these problems, we propose the use of fuzzy logic-based pre-classifier as a means of treating uncertainty to improve the classification accuracy of tropical wood recognition system. The pre-classifier serve as a clustering mechanism for the large database simplifying the classification process making it more efficient. The use of the fuzzy logic-based pre-classifier has managed to increase the accuracy of the wood recognition system by 4 % and reduce the processing time for training and testing by more than 75 % and 26 % respectively.  相似文献

In earlier work, we presented a value based measure of cybersecurity that quantifies the security of a system in concrete terms, specifically, in terms of how much each system stakeholder stands to lose (in dollars per hour of operation) as a result of security threats and system vulnerabilities; our metric varies according to the stakes that each stakeholder has in meeting each security requirement. In this paper, we discuss the specification and design of a system that collects, updates, and maintains all the information that pertains to estimating our cybersecurity measure, and offers stakeholders quantitative means to make security-related decisions.  相似文献

Cu/Y1Ba2Cu3O7?x superconducting composite wires have been fabricated using the powder-in-tube coextrusion process. Increase in load during the extrusion process seems to indicate that powder particles from the deformation zone of the die travel up toward the unextruded part of the billet and gradually increase the density in that part to some saturation value, which prohibits further extrusion at moderate to heavy applied load. A powder removal technique has been devised to perform full length extrusion under such conditions. Powder removal, however, is not required if the extrusion ratio is reduced sufficiently. The extrusion ratio that will give a full length extrusion without powder removal seems to be a function of starting billet length. Extrusion ratio of 2.52 gives smooth full length extrusions with 25.4 mm (1 in.) starting billet length at reasonable load values. Four probe resistivity and magnetic susceptibility measurements indicate a critical temperature (Tc) value of the formed wire to be close to 88 K. Since the discovery of the electrochemical discharge phenomenon by Fizeau and Foucault, several contributions have expanded the wide range of applications associated with this high current density electrochemical process. The complexity of the phenomenon, from the macroscopic to the microscopic scales, led since then to experimental and theoretical studies from different research fields. This contribution reviews the chemical and electrochemical perspectives where a mechanistic model based on results from radiation chemistry of aqueous solutions is proposed. In addition applications to micro-machining and fabrication of nanoparticles are discussed.  相似文献
